Ingredients
To create these delicious Honey Butter Rice Cakes, you’ll need the following ingredients:
For the Rice Cakes
- 1 pound Korean rice cakes
- 1 tablespoon neutral oil
For the Honey Butter Sauce
- 1/4 cup butter
- 2 tablespoons honey
- 2 tablespoons brown sugar
- 2 tablespoons soy sauce
How to Make Honey Butter Rice Cakes
Step 1: Prepare the Rice Cakes
If you’re using frozen or refrigerated rice cakes:
1. Soak them in water for 20-30 minutes or follow package instructions.
2. Dry them with a kitchen towel.
If you’re using fresh rice cakes, you can skip this step.
Step 2: Fry the Rice Cakes
- Heat one tablespoon of o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at.
- Add the soaked rice cakes to the skillet without touching them.
- Fry for about two minutes until the bottom is crispy and slightly golden.
- Flip the rice cakes carefully using a spatula and cook for an additional 3 minutes until colored evenly.
- Remove the cooked rice cakes to a plate.
Step 3: Make the Honey Butter Sauce
- Reduce heat to medium.
- Add butter, honey, brown sugar, and soy sauce to the skillet.
- Stir continuously for about 1 minute until sugar fully dissolves.
Step 4: Combine and Serve
- Return the fried rice cakes to the pan with the sauce.
- Toss them gently to coat evenly with sauce.
- Cook together for another 1-2 minutes until sauce reduces to a glaze.
- Serve immediately and enjoy your homemade Honey Butter Rice Cakes!

How to Perfect Honey Butter Rice Cakes
To ensure your Honey Butter Rice Cakes turn out perfectly every time, consider these simple tips.
- Use fresh rice cakes: Fresh rice cakes provide the best texture and flavor. If using frozen ones, make sure they are fully thawed before cooking.
- Don’t overcrowd the pan: Fry rice cakes in batches if necessary. This helps them get crispy without sticking together.
- Adjust sweetness: Feel free to tweak the amount of honey and brown sugar depending on your taste preference for sweetness.
- Monitor the heat: Keep an eye on your skillet’s temperature. Too high can burn the ingredients; too low won’t give you that desired crispiness.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Making Honey Butter Rice Cakes can be simple, but there are a few common mistakes that can affect the outcome. Here’s how to avoid them:
- Bold phrase: Not soaking the rice cakes. If you use frozen or refrigerated rice cakes, soaking is essential to achieve the right texture and prevent them from being too hard.
- Bold phrase: Overcrowding the pan. Frying too many rice cakes at once can lead to uneven cooking. Always give them space to crisp up nicely.
- Bold phrase: Skipping the resting time. Allowing the cooked rice cakes to rest for a minute before serving helps them absorb the honey butter glaze better.
- Bold phrase: Using too much heat. Cooking at too high a temperature can burn the glaze and ruin the flavor. Keep it medium for best results.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
- Ensure they are completely cooled before sealing to maintain freshness.
Freezing Honey Butter Rice Cakes
- Freeze in a single layer on a baking sheet for about 1 hour.
- Transfer to a freezer-safe bag or container for up to 2 months.
Reheating Honey Butter Rice Cakes
- Bold phrase: Oven – Preheat to 350°F (175°C) and bake for about 10 minutes until warmed through.
- Bold phrase: Microwave – Place on a microwave-safe plate, cover with a damp paper towel, and heat for 30-second intervals until hot.
- Bold phrase: Stovetop – Heat in a skillet over low heat, adding a splash of water if needed, until warmed and slightly crispy.
